Richard Choate was born in 1722 in Choates Fancy, Baltimore, Maryland, United States, the child of Christopher Vi Choate And Flora Susannah Hawkins. Richard Choate married Nancy Anderson, and had children including Aaron C Choate, Augustine Choate, Christopher Choate, Edward Choate, Emmanuel Choate, Greenberry Choate, Prudence Choate. Richard Choate passed away in 1788 in Sullivan County, Tennessee, USA.
